What the check requires

Choose exactly one safe-use path: either the sufficiency statement or explicit safe-use instructions. ECHA does not allow both in the same Article record.

How it gets fixed

Check the source system and replace the value with an allowed value identified by the rule; do not map it by guesswork. Run validation again. Clearlane never fills a compliance value by guessing.
